"本资源是李勇平主讲的ASP.NET2.0 C#基础教程,旨在帮助初学者理解和掌握ASP.NET应用程序开发。"
本课程主要针对ASP.NET的初学者,旨在使学习者能够运用ASP.NET技术开发电子商务类的网站和其他类似应用。教程由资深软件工程师李勇平主讲,他具有丰富的网站项目开发经验,如CMS系统和流媒体管理控制系统等,并有多部编程教材出版。
课程内容详细涵盖了以下几个关键知识点:
1. **ASP.NET页面技术**:ASP.NET页面是构建动态网页的基础,学习者将了解到如何创建、管理和交互HTML控件,以及如何利用服务器端代码控制页面行为。
2. **Web应用程序请求-应答模式**:讲解了HTTP协议下,ASP.NET应用程序如何处理用户请求并生成应答的过程,包括页面生命周期和事件模型。
3. **ASP.NET代码(C#)**:C#是ASP.NET的主要编程语言,学习者将学习到如何编写和执行C#代码来实现网页逻辑,包括控制结构、类和对象、异常处理等。
4. **数据访问技术:ADO.NET**:ADO.NET是.NET Framework中用于数据库操作的重要组件,课程会介绍如何连接数据库、执行SQL语句、填充数据集以及使用数据绑定技术在网页上展示数据。
5. **应用程序状态管理**:ASP.NET提供了多种机制来维护应用程序和用户的状态,如视图状态、隐藏字段、Cookie、Session和Application等,学习者将了解何时和如何使用这些状态管理方法。
此外,课程可能还会涉及Visual Studio.NET 2005的使用,这是微软提供的集成开发环境,用于创建和调试ASP.NET应用程序。学习者将学习如何利用其丰富的功能来提高开发效率。
通过这门课程,初学者不仅能够理解ASP.NET的基本概念,如动态网页、IIS(Internet Information Services)和.NET Framework,还将学会如何实际操作,运用所学知识开发功能丰富的Web应用程序。同时,李勇平老师的实战经验和教学方式将帮助学习者更好地理解和掌握ASP.NET2.0的相关技术。